I did a 949-mile road trip right after I put the tires on back in May. I averaged 23.2 MPG with most of the driving at freeway speeds.

I'm not sure what it is now as most of my miles are either low speeds around town or even lower speeds on the trails with the occasional short trip on the freeway. And, of course, it's been lifted since I made that trip.

I did not regear. The 8spd/3.45:1 gear combination seems to work well. That size tire which is 33.8" tall at recommended PSI which is 1.7" taller than the stock 255's at recommended PSI.

I am running the 285/70/17 on my 2020 Willys! NO spacers, no rubbing problems at all (first picture without the spring lift). I did have steinjager adjustable control arms and track bars in preparation for the 33s and spring lift. Still didnā€™t rub without the springs though
Jeep Wrangler JL Willys Stock Tire Size Question EABB1093-0E5C-45BD-87C2-C85E75A61BD1

Second picture is when I upgraded the end links, Fox ATS steering stabilizer and got some take off rubicon springs (taken off the unlimited rubicons equipped with steel bumpers) from Rubitrux which gave me about 1.5-2 inches. Full articulation no rubbing (and running front and rear steel bumpers) love it
Jeep Wrangler JL Willys Stock Tire Size Question 4F1A7A5F-FC15-434B-90D9-4290F06CE13E

Jeep Wrangler JL Willys Stock Tire Size Question E01997A7-8446-4996-B093-48EE6BE52EE2


Spare fit great in the back, both with my stock bumper and my new steel one. Itā€™s just the perfect set up Iā€™m telling you. (See last picture below)

I also added a throttle body spacer, cold air intake and a cat back 3inch exhaust and gave it a lot of horsepower and torque to help handle the difference in everything. 3.6 L Etorque, she purrs now, my husband compared it to his 3.7 L 2017 Mustang with flowmaster outlaws and a 3 inch X pipe lmfao. Traded my 2018 GT for this Jeep and the 33s let me keep every bit of the horsepower and torque gains front mods without regearing āœŒšŸ¼

Does anyone know or venture to guess why Jeep chose to use Firestone size LT255/75R17 over Firestone LT285/70R17 since they both fit the stock Willys wheels?

The Firestone LT285/70R17 does not appear to be available in OWL or Load C so maybe that's the reason???
